예스스탁
예스스탁 답변
2024-07-25 17:18:32
안녕하세요
예스스탁입니다.
1
input : 단위(0.05);
var : 전환선(0),기준선(0);
var : pp(0),ll(0),tx(0);
전환선 = (highest(H,9)+lowest(L,9))/2;
기준선 = (highest(H,26)+lowest(L,26))/2;
if CrossUp(전환선,기준선) Then
Buy("b");
if CrossDown(전환선,기준선) Then
ExitLong("bx");
if MarketPosition == 1 Then
{
pp = Floor(((highest(H,BarsSinceEntry)-EntryPrice)/EntryPrice*100)/단위);
if pp > pp[1] Then
{
tx = Text_New(sdate,stime,H+PriceScale*1,NumToStr(pp*단위,2)+"%");
Text_SetStyle(tx,2,1);#텍스트
}
}
2
input : 단위(10);
var : 전환선(0),기준선(0);
var : pp(0),ll(0),tx(0);
전환선 = (highest(H,9)+lowest(L,9))/2;
기준선 = (highest(H,26)+lowest(L,26))/2;
if CrossDown(전환선,기준선) Then
Sell("s");
if CrossUp(전환선,기준선) Then
ExitShort("sx");
if MarketPosition == -1 Then
{
pp = Floor(((EntryPrice-lowest(L,BarsSinceEntry))/EntryPrice*100)/단위);
if pp > pp[1] Then
{
tx = Text_New(sdate,stime,L-PriceScale*1,NumToStr(pp*단위,2)+"%");
Text_SetStyle(tx,2,0);
}
}
즐거운 하루되세요
> tops 님이 쓴 글입니다.
> 제목 : 88239 추가 질의 드립니다
> 1. 캔들의 종가를 기준으로 0.05% 단위로 "0.00% 수익" 이 나오게 하고 싶습니다.
단, 장의 흐름에 따라서,
봉의 길이가 짧은 경우에는.. 0.05% 수익 → 0.1% 수익 → 0.15% 수익.. 등등 으로 표기 될수 있지만..
만일 장의 급등락 발생될 경우(장대 양봉/음봉이 발생될 경우)에는..
0.1% 수익 → 0.2% 수익 → 0.3% 수익 이런식으로 유도리 있게 표기 될 수 있도록..
수식 작성이 가능할까요?(해당 캔들의 고가/저가 기준)
2. "% 수익" 표기 위치 조정
"틱" 차트 또는 "분" 차트에서 나오는,
"0.00% 수익"의 글자위치(=발생위치)도 임의로 조절이 가능한건지요?
예를들면,
(1) "매수" 신호로 발생되는 "0.00% 수익"의 텍스트 위치는.. 캔들(봉) 위에
(2) "매도" 신호로 발생되는 "0.00% 수익"의 텍스트 위치는.. 캔들(봉) 아래에 표시